Loss of College Degree, Because of a Picture
This is the sort of thing that makes me angry. This poor girl worked hard, took all her classes and earned her degree. When the time came to get her degree from millersville university of Pennsylvania they denied it to her based on a picture she posted on her own personal Web site.

"university officials found a picture of Snyder sipping from a plastic cup and wearing a pirate cap. Beneath the picture were the words: "Drunken Pirate." The results were life-changing." ~Online Universities Weblog (apr 30)

This is just wrong. If she took the classes and earned the credits then there's no way the college should have the right to deny her the degree she earned just because of a picture. A harmless picture at that. What people do outside of school or work shouldn't have an bearing on their ability to succeed.
